Roger Munnings

Independent Director at Sistema

Graduated from the Oxford University with a degree of Master of Arts in Politics, Philosophy, Economics.

Roger Munnings’s principal career was, from 1974 to 2008, with the international “Big Four” accounting, consulting and auditing firm, KPMG. In 1996-2008, he was Chairman and President of KPMG Russia and the CIS. In 1993-2008, was Chairman of KPMG’s Global Energy and Natural Resources Practice and in 1998-2008, member of KPMG’s International Council, the firm's senior governance body.

Mr Munnings has been actively involved in public life in Russia. He is currently Chairman of the Russo-British Chamber of Commerce, a member of the Russian National Council on Corporate Governance, the Russian Union of Industrialists and Entrepreneurs, the Russian Institute of Directors, etc. In the past, he was Deputy Chairman of the Executive Board of the Association of European Businesses in Russia, a member of the Board of the US Russia Business Council, Chairman of the Audit Committee Institute in Russia and a member of the UK Government’s working group on trade and investment between Russia and Great Britain.

Since June 2015 Roger Munnings has been a member of the Board of PJSC LUKoil as an independent director and Chairman of its Human Resources Committee.

He has also been an independent director of JSC SUEK.
